How Can I Add a Link to an Email?
Last updated: March 26, 2026
Important note before we proceed: We generally do not recommend adding any links to the emails, as it has an impact on deliverability and may result in some emails landing in spam.
But, if adding a link is necessary, below are the ways to achieve the desired result.
🪄 Easiest Way — Use the “Give Feedback” Button
The simplest and fastest way to add a link to your email sequence is by leaving feedback directly on your generated sequence.
Here’s how:
Preview sequence in the campaigns you'll be launching.

Once the sequence is ready for review, locate and click the Give Feedback button.

A feedback field will open — this is where you can write specific instructions for the AI.
Be specific about placement and avoid conditional or vague phrasing.
Example: Each initial email must have a link to the event [link] added to the second paragraph.
After entering your instruction, save the feedback.
The persona will automatically adjust its rules within a few seconds based on your feedback.Regenerate the sequence with the same persona to review the updates — your link should now appear in the follow-up messages according to your rule.

AiSDR doesn't support hyperlinks (clickable words, phrases, image, or buttons, that direct users to the specified webpage). The link will be sent exactly the way you input it, so make sure to use a short one that won't look suspicious to the prospect.
Here are some examples of the rules that work:
Add a sentence at the end of each follow-up email with an intent to book a demo meeting with this link: https://calendly.com/example.
Add the sentence at the end of the third follow-up email with an intent to book a demo meeting with the link: https://calendly.com/example.
Tip: This method is the easiest because it doesn’t require editing persona prompts or settings manually. It’s quick, intuitive, and ensures that links appear where you want them, without extra configuration.
đź”§ Manual Prompt Editing (For More Control)
If you prefer full control over link placement and behaviour, you can edit the persona manually:
Go to Persona → Edit.

Scroll down in the Email Rules section.
Define where and how links should appear — for example, only in follow-up emails, or only when referencing a specific CTA:
A. Inside the Mandatory follow-up email rules section, add a new instruction like:
Links are allowed in follow-up emails when explicitly requested in this prompt.
The third follow-up email must always end with this exact line on its own line:
Book a demo meeting here: https://calendly.com/example.

B. Edit the follow-up example block
Inside your persona’s prompt under: <follow-up_email_examples_to_follow> → <follow_up_email_3>
You adjust the message and make sure the line with the link is added:
<follow_up_email_3>
When outreach reaches the wrong buyers and response rates stay low, your product market fit validation slows down.
Learning cycles drag. Go-to-market capital gets deployed inefficiently. Growth commitments become harder to hit.
Personalized messaging that increases response rates by 35% means faster feedback loops and smarter capital allocation.
Book a demo meeting here: https://calendly.com/
</follow_up_email_3>
This makes it part of the example, which the AI will mimic for future sequences.
You can also add your URLs to the Useful Resources section. This allows the AI to naturally reference them in messages whenever relevant. Note that you won’t be able to control or predict exactly where or when the link appears — the AI will include it only when it considers it contextually appropriate.
